Furthermore, the sound design plays a crucial role. In a game centered around domestic life, the absence of sound is just as important as its presence. The rustling of clothes, the ambient noise of the apartment, and the voice acting (if present in the specific version) all contribute to the illusion of companionship. The game creates a "lived-in" feeling, making the digital space feel like a home rather than just a backdrop for text boxes. -ENG- Living Together with Akari-chan -RJ011642...
